88 
89 /*
90  * For the currently used signature algorithms the buffer to store any signature
91  * must be at least of size MAX(MBEDTLS_ECDSA_MAX_LEN, MBEDTLS_MPI_MAX_SIZE)
92  */
93 #if MBEDTLS_ECDSA_MAX_LEN > MBEDTLS_MPI_MAX_SIZE
94 #define SIGNATURE_MAX_SIZE MBEDTLS_ECDSA_MAX_LEN
95 #else
96 #define SIGNATURE_MAX_SIZE MBEDTLS_MPI_MAX_SIZE
97 #endif
98 
main(int argc,char * argv[])99 int main( int argc, char *argv[] )
100 {
101     FILE *f;
102     int ret = 1;
103     int exit_code = MBEDTLS_EXIT_FAILURE;
104     mbedtls_pk_context pk;
105     mbedtls_entropy_context entropy;
106     mbedtls_ctr_drbg_context ctr_drbg;
107     unsigned char hash[32];
108     unsigned char buf[SIGNATURE_MAX_SIZE];
109     char filename[512];
110     const char *pers = "mbedtls_pk_sign";
111     size_t olen = 0;
112 
113     mbedtls_entropy_init( &entropy );
114     mbedtls_ctr_drbg_init( &ctr_drbg );
115     mbedtls_pk_init( &pk );
116 
117     if( argc != 3 )
118     {
119         mbedtls_printf( "usage: mbedtls_pk_sign <key_file> <filename>\n" );
120 
121 #if defined(_WIN32)
122         mbedtls_printf( "\n" );
123 #endif
124 
125         goto exit;
126     }
127 
128     mbedtls_printf( "\n  . Seeding the random number generator..." );
129     fflush( stdout );
130 
131     if( ( ret = mbedtls_ctr_drbg_seed( &ctr_drbg, mbedtls_entropy_func, &entropy,
132                                (const unsigned char *) pers,
133                                strlen( pers ) ) ) != 0 )
134     {
135         mbedtls_printf( " failed\n  ! mbedtls_ctr_drbg_seed returned -0x%04x\n", -ret );
136         goto exit;
137     }
138 
139     mbedtls_printf( "\n  . Reading private key from '%s'", argv[1] );
140     fflush( stdout );
141 
142     if( ( ret = mbedtls_pk_parse_keyfile( &pk, argv[1], "" ) ) != 0 )
143     {
144         mbedtls_printf( " failed\n  ! Could not parse '%s'\n", argv[1] );
145         goto exit;
146     }
147 
148     /*
149      * Compute the SHA-256 hash of the input file,
150      * then calculate the signature of the hash.
151      */
152     mbedtls_printf( "\n  . Generating the SHA-256 signature" );
153     fflush( stdout );
154 
155     if( ( ret = mbedtls_md_file(
156                     mbedtls_md_info_from_type( MBEDTLS_MD_SHA256 ),
157                     argv[2], hash ) ) != 0 )
158     {
159         mbedtls_printf( " failed\n  ! Could not open or read %s\n\n", argv[2] );
160         goto exit;
161     }
162 
163     if( ( ret = mbedtls_pk_sign( &pk, MBEDTLS_MD_SHA256, hash, 0, buf, &olen,
164                          mbedtls_ctr_drbg_random, &ctr_drbg ) ) != 0 )
165     {
166         mbedtls_printf( " failed\n  ! mbedtls_pk_sign returned -0x%04x\n", -ret );
167         goto exit;
168     }
169 
170     /*
171      * Write the signature into <filename>.sig
172      */
173     mbedtls_snprintf( filename, sizeof(filename), "%s.sig", argv[2] );
174 
175     if( ( f = fopen( filename, "wb+" ) ) == NULL )
176     {
177         mbedtls_printf( " failed\n  ! Could not create %s\n\n", filename );
178         goto exit;
179     }
180 
181     if( fwrite( buf, 1, olen, f ) != olen )
182     {
183         mbedtls_printf( "failed\n  ! fwrite failed\n\n" );
184         fclose( f );
185         goto exit;
186     }
187 
188     fclose( f );
189 
190     mbedtls_printf( "\n  . Done (created \"%s\")\n\n", filename );
191 
192     exit_code = MBEDTLS_EXIT_SUCCESS;
193 
194 exit:
195     mbedtls_pk_free( &pk );
196     mbedtls_ctr_drbg_free( &ctr_drbg );
197     mbedtls_entropy_free( &entropy );
198 
199 #if defined(MBEDTLS_ERROR_C)
200     if( exit_code != MBEDTLS_EXIT_SUCCESS )
201     {
202         mbedtls_strerror( ret, (char *) buf, sizeof(buf) );
203         mbedtls_printf( "  !  Last error was: %s\n", buf );
204     }
205 #endif
206 
207 #if defined(_WIN32)
208     mbedtls_printf( "  + Press Enter to exit this program.\n" );
209     fflush( stdout ); getchar();
210 #endif
211 
212     mbedtls_exit( exit_code );
213 }
